Choose between the 5.25 hour Surprise Glacier Cruise and the 4.5 hour Blackstone Glacier Cruise. All trips are hosted by a Chugach National Forest Ranger. At the glaciers you'll often witness calving - a process by which glaciers shed giant blocks of ancient ice. This area is also home to a wide variety of animals including sea lions, seals, sea otters,and mountain goats; as well as an abundance of bird rookeries with many species including eagles and kittywakes. You can enhance your experience with our Alaska salmon and prime rib buffet, freshly prepared on board the vessel. All guests are guaranteed reserved seating inside our heated cabins. « less
